The opening of the movie made me see the signs of a bad movie. Isn't this a movie with no technical content at all? (I just watched it, I thought it was like Shoot'Em Up, too bad) The cutting method is also There are too many, it feels like MTV or an advertisement, but when the real protagonist of the film - the little brat appears, the excitement will come to the fore.
In general, it is violent and suspenseful enough. The n clues are connected together, and it is indeed a bit of the tough style of To Qifeng's police and bandit films. Unfortunately, the main line is not clear, suddenly guns, suddenly children, suddenly social problems (seems like The most perverted people ran out all at once), looking a little dazzled.
In fact, this is more like an urban hero fairy tale full of violence. Although there are a lot of dirty things, the ending is still happy and beautiful, unlike Hong Kong-made films such as "Infernal Affairs" and "Evil Eyes".
